Output 59e65b593a90d9e2e1332019b45b30141b1270978bba292b29d59d77b5a8a642:0

value
87588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53cc3e677c6d1f52becc5dd488cef8e03aaec68e OP_EQUAL
address
39L6ga6LBZwDqyWmVPriEQyhrNa46iP5Qk
transaction
59e65b593a90d9e2e1332019b45b30141b1270978bba292b29d59d77b5a8a642
spent
true